Utah Football Signs DB Cory Butler

Utah announced the signing of four-star defensive back Cory Butler out of Los Angeles Harbor Community College today. Butler will enroll at the University of Utah as a junior with three years to play two. He was rated No. 26 on ESPN.com's JC 50 list.

This past season, Butler earned National Division-Central Conference second-team defense honors. As a sophomore cornerback at L.A. Harbor, he had 46 tackles, four tackles for a loss, five interceptions, six pass breakups, and a fumble recovery. Butler led L.A. Harbor in kickoff returns (18 for 445 yards, 24.7 average, 1 TD) and punt returns (nine for 36 yards). As a freshman at L.A. Harbor in 2013, he had 42 receptions for 583 yards, with seven touchdowns, and rushed 66 times for 327 yards (5 yards per carry average) and two touchdowns.

This was the recruit the Utes couldn't afford to let slip away. They didn't, and Butler (which Utah lists at 5-9, 175) adds to an already loaded secondary for 2015. According to Hudl, he was clocked at 4.35 in the 40, giving the Utes another burner on the corner who can run with Pac-12 wideouts.

Butler's film* shows a sure handed defensive back with some serious wheels. He's elusive in the return game, shifty, and can flat outrun others. He's disciplined, focused, and can lay the wood on opposing wide receivers. He stays with his assignments but can step up in run support. With his speed and tenacity, Butler is just the kind of blitzer Whittingham's defensive coordinators like to bring off the edge from the secondary. He also gets off blocks and makes some nice hits in the open field.
